2. CV Parsing: Contextual Understanding

The Evolution of Parsing

Traditional ParsingAI Parsing 2025
Fixed rulesContextual understanding
Errors on varied formatsAdapts to any layout
Frequent manual correction>95% accuracy
Undetected duplicatesSmart detection
Manual updatesUpdate suggestions

What AI Parsing Captures

  • Contact information (email, phone, LinkedIn)
  • Work experience with dates and responsibilities
  • Skills technical and soft
  • Education and certifications
  • Languages and levels
  • Location and mobility

Duplicate Detection

AI detects non-obvious duplicates:

  • Same person with different emails
  • Partially filled profiles
  • Existing CV updates
AI shows exactly what needs updating, avoiding duplicate profiles that pollute your database.

3. Screening & Matching: Automatic Ranking

The Volume Challenge

When your database overflows with CVs, screening AI makes it easy to quickly spot the best candidates.

Manually reviewing thousands of applicants is neither practical nor necessary in 2025.

How AI Matching Works

StepAI Action
1. Job analysisUnderstanding key criteria
2. Database scanEvaluating all candidates
3. ScoringAssigning relevance scores
4. RankingOrdering by descending score
5. ExplanationJustifying each score
Result: You focus on the most promising profiles instead of going through all CVs one by one.

Bidirectional Matching

Modern AI does matching both ways:

TypeDescription
Candidate → JobsWhich jobs match this candidate?
Job → CandidatesWhich candidates match this job?
ProactiveNotification when a good match appears

4. Pipeline Management: Proactive AI

Time Lost in Coordination

Coordinating interviews takes valuable time and is prone to human error.

What AI Automates

TaskAI Automation
Conversation trackingReal-time tracking
Status updatesAutomatic
Interview schedulingAI-proposed slots
Follow-upsAutomatic sending
RemindersSmart notifications
Next actionsAI suggestions

Next Step Suggestions

AI recommends next actions for each candidate:

  • "This candidate has been waiting for a response for 5 days"
  • "Schedule technical interview"
  • "Send offer — all interviews validated"
  • "Follow up with client for feedback"
You never miss a high-potential candidate or important action.

7. Outreach: Personalization at Scale

The Personalization Challenge

Contacting hundreds of candidates while staying personal and relevant is challenging.

What AI Brings to Outreach

CapabilityBenefit
Auto personalizationMessages adapted to each profile
Multichannel sequencesEmail + LinkedIn + SMS + WhatsApp
Optimal timingSending at the best moment
Response detectionAutomatic tracking
A/B testingContinuous optimization
Smart templatesVariant generation

AI Sequence Example

DayChannelAction
D+0LinkedInPersonalized connection request
D+2LinkedInFollow-up message if accepted
D+4EmailPersonalized email if no response
D+7SMSShort reminder if priority profile
D+10EmailFinal follow-up with new approach

Reverse Matching: Your Database as Sales Engine

When connected to an external vacancy database, AI matching transforms your candidate database into a predictable, high-quality sales engine:

  1. New job detected in market
  2. AI matches with your existing candidates
  3. Notification to sales rep
  4. Proactive proposal to client
